WebAug 1, 1994 · In other words, if the rust or mill scale is light, it will not affect the bond to the concrete. In fact, studies have shown that mill scale and light rust enhance the bond … dyes definition chemistryWebreinforcing bar. Rust can enhance the bond character-istics of the bar to the surrounding concrete. Obviously, loose material should be removed from the bar. Tightly adhering rust or mill scale is permissible, and will not be detrimental to bond.
